关于 flowcontrol——流控制在直连的以太端口上启用,在拥塞期间允许另一端拥塞的节点暂停链路运作来控制流量速率。如果一个端口发生拥塞并且不能接收任何更多的流量,他将通知对端端口停止发送直到这种拥塞情况消失。当本地设备在他本地检测到了任何拥塞,他能够发送一个暂停帧通知链路伙伴或者远程设备已发生拥塞。紧随收到暂停帧之后,远程设备停止发送任何数据包,这样防止在拥塞期间丢弃
转载 精选 2010-07-27 12:48:31
2001阅读
FlowControl Practise 打印三角形 将三角形用矩形锁住,分成四部分 1.倒三角空白部分 2.正三角符号部分 import java.util.Scanner; public class Practise01 { public static void main(String[] ar ...
转载 2021-09-25 13:59:00
81阅读
2评论
FlowControl 流程控制 什么是流程控制? 控制流程(也称为流程控制)是计算机运算领域的用语,意指在程序运行时,个别的指令(或是陈述、子程序)运行或求值的顺序。 不论是在声明式编程语言或是函数编程语言中,都有类似的概念。 基本的三种流程结构: - 顺序结构,自上而下的一般结构 - 分支结构,
转载 2020-04-15 15:58:00
66阅读
2评论
MongoDB 4.2 版本引入了流量控制特性,用于保持副本集多数提交延迟不超过指定的最大值,从而确保数据的一致性和可靠性。如果复制延迟达到"flowControlTargetLagSeconds" : 10(秒),流量控制机制就会开始限制主节点上的写入操作。db.adminCommand( { getParameter : 1, "flowControlTargetLagSeconds" : 1
原创 2023-10-13 14:25:41
701阅读
typedef struct  {  bool configured; // 配置与否  uint8 baudRate; // 波特率  bool flowControl; // 流控制  uint16 flowControlThreshold;  //在RX缓存达到
原创 2022-02-18 10:42:35
55阅读
简介 HTTP2相对于http1.1来说一个重要的提升就是流控制flowcontrol。为什么会有流控制
原创 2022-09-19 16:18:16
52阅读
typedef struct  {  bool configured; // 配置与否  uint8 baudRate; // 波特率  bool flowControl; // 流控制  uint16 flowControlThreshold;  //在RX缓存达到maxRxBufSize之前还有多少字节空余。当到达maxRxBufSize –
原创 2021-12-08 11:37:45
728阅读
网卡设置 网卡的高级设置说明修改电脑网卡高级设置可以提高网络速度。另外,建议关闭在Realtek网卡高级设置中的以下其他选项:流控制/FlowControl、巨型帧/Jumboframe、大量传送负载/OffloadLargesend、EEE(Energy Efficient Ethernet)、环保节能/GreenEthernet、硬件效验和/OffloadChksum。自动关闭 PCIe (省
修改注册表键值,有的网卡只有其中一项 "Jumboframe"="0" "FlowControl"="0" "Largesend"="0" "HwParaMask"=dword:00000000 "HwFPSM"=dword:
原创 2012-12-01 21:05:38
1406阅读
在3550 EMI上做速率限制是采用QOS的速率管制功能(policying),依次需要做如下配置。 1、在所有端口上关闭流量控制   3550(config)#interface range gigabitEthernet 0/1 - 123550(config-if-range)#flowcontrol receive off3550(config-if-range)#fl
转载 精选 2008-04-19 10:58:10
1177阅读
1评论
官方教程:https://tour.go-zh.org/flowcontrol/11 没有条件的 switch 同 switch true 一样。 这一构造使得可以用更清晰的形式来编写长的 if-then-else 链。 官方示例: package main import ( "fmt" "time" ) func main() { t := time.Now() //这里没有条件
转载 2017-02-10 11:52:00
98阅读
2评论
Java中的程序流程控制Java中的程序流程分为三种结构:①顺序结构;②分支结构;③循环结构一.顺序结构  Java中定义成员变量的时候,采用的是前向引用,也就是后面的变量可以引用之前定义好的变量。 public class FlowControl { public static void main(String[] args) { // 正确引用 in
Java中的程序流程控制Java中的程序流程分为三种结构:①顺序结构;②分支结构;③循环结构一.顺序结构  Java中定义成员变量的时候,采用的是前向引用,也就是后面的变量可以引用之前定义好的变量。public class FlowControl { public static void main(String[] args) { // 正确引用 int n
转载 2023-05-24 14:09:57
25阅读
Cirrus Logic的clps7111~Ep9312 系列ARM core的CPU内置128 字节的boot 程 序。这个boot程序为把操作系统下载到裸机提供了极大的方便。这样再焊接电路 板之前不用把操作系统预先写入Flash,而且日后升级操作系统也非常方便。这个boot程序的功能是:1. 设置串行口的参数为:9600, 8N1,No FlowControl。2. 然后送出一个<
先前有一篇博文,梳理了流控服务的场景、业界做法和常用算法统一流控服务开源-1:场景&业界做法&算法篇最近完成了流控服务的开发,并在生产系统进行了大半年的验证,稳定可靠。今天整理一下核心设计和实现思路,开源到Github上,分享给大家     https://github.com/zhouguoqing/FlowControl 一、令牌桶算法实
转载 2月前
10阅读
RocketMQ是一款开源的分布式消息中间件,具备高可用、高性能和可扩展性等特点。在实际应用中,我们可能会面临消息生产和消费的压力过大的情况,这时就需要使用流控来控制消息的发送速率,以保证系统的稳定性和可靠性。本文将介绍RocketMQ的流控功能,并给出相应的代码示例。 ## 什么是流控 流控(FlowControl)指的是通过限制消息的发送速率来控制系统负载的一种机制。在高并发的消息发送场景
原创 2024-01-09 23:35:19
271阅读
一,Go 只有一种循环结构—— for 循环。 官方教程:https://tour.go-zh.org/flowcontrol/1 Go 只有一种循环结构—— for 循环。 基本的 for 循环包含三个由分号分开的组成部分: 初始化语句:在第一次循环执行前被执行 循环条件表达式:每轮迭代开始前被求值 后置语句:每轮迭代后被执行 初始化语句一般是一个短变量声明,这里声明的变量仅在整个 for 循环
转载 2017-02-10 11:43:00
98阅读
2评论
学习的Python开发很难吗?适合于新手吗?python语言对于初学者是非常友好的,是编程语言中比较好学习一门编程语言。 先分享一个关于Python+数据分析万能编程语言宝藏网站,贯穿数据始终学习路线图想要获得么? Python+数据分析 由于以下原因,Python很适合作为零基础的学生学习:1.语法简单明了,Python语言实际上是语法+Flowcontrol,而Python的语法简单的代码可读
RabbitMq 性能调优记录要避免流控机制触发服务端默认配置是当内存使用达到40%,磁盘空闲空间小于50M,即启动内存报警,磁盘报警;报警后服务端触发流控(flowcontrol)机制。一般地,当发布端发送消息速度快于订阅端消费消息的速度时,队列中堆积了大量的消息,导致报警,就会触发流控机制。触发流控机制后,RabbitMQ服务端接收发布来的消息会变慢,使得进入队列的消息减少;与此同时Rabbi
转载 2024-03-07 12:01:11
359阅读
避免雷区要避免流控机制触发服务端默认配置是当内存使用达到40%,磁盘空闲空间小于50M,即启动内存报警,磁盘报警;报警后服务端触发流控(flowcontrol)机制。一般地,当发布端发送消息速度快于订阅端消费消息的速度时,队列中堆积了大量的消息,导致报警,就会触发流控机制。触发流控机制后,RabbitMQ服务端接收发布来的消息会变慢,使得进入队列的消息减少;与此同时RabbitMQ服务端的消息推送
转载 2024-07-14 19:29:41
65阅读
  • 1
  • 2